Abstract

We describe a novel surgical simulator designed to train and assess an orthopaedic residents surgical skill on the tasks of fracture reduction and surgical wire navigation. We use a unique approach of combining accurate surgical models created using patient CT data along with a 3D tracking system that allows for realistic, real-time imaging along with automated performance tracking and benchmarking. Additionally, we have devised a method for tracking the surgical wire associated with the procedure to allow for a complete simulation of reducing and pinning a pediatric elbow fracture.
